MILAN STEVULAK was born in the small mining town of Hillcrest, Alberta. From a young age Milan was interested in drawing the scenic surroundings of the Crows Nest Pass area.
Although primarily self taught, Milan has in recent years taken instruction from a number of Canadian Artists such as Kiff Holland, Fred Schafer, David Langevin and participated in Federation of Canadian Artists workshops involving instructors such as Mike Svob, Robert Genn, and Alan Wylie. Milan is an Active Member of the Federation of Canadian Artists.
Milan works in watercolour and acrylics creating in landscapes, seascapes and still life.
"I am inspired by images which connect with me in an emotional way and I try to create paintings which will elicit an emotional response from the viewer. My objective is to involve the viewer by evoking memories of a place, a time or a feeling. I like to use rich bright colours with strong contrasts to create mood and feeling."
Recently retired from the financial services industry and having moved to Salt Spring Island, Milan is now devoting his time to studying and practicing his "art."
